概括
肺动脉速度时间积分 (VTI) 有效地评估急性肺损伤 (ALI) 的严重程度. 结合肺动脉VTI与动脉纠正流量时间 (FTc),为ALI评估提供了强大的诊断性能.
科学领域:
- 心血管生理学心血管生理学
- 肺部医学 肺部医学
- 诊断成像 诊断成像 诊断成像
背景情况:
- 系统体积状态对于急性肺损伤 (ALI) 的进展和管理至关重要.
- 在ALI中对系统体积变化的非侵入性监测具有临床意义.
研究的目的:
- 评估动脉和心脏超声波参数在评估ALI严重性的有用性.
- 在ALI中确定肺动脉速度-时间积分 (VTI) 和动脉校正流量时间 (FTc) 的诊断性能.
主要方法:
- 用油酸诱导山羊,以创建轻度和严重的ALI模型.
- 进行了心血管超声波 (直径,FTc) 和心脏超声波 (大动脉和肺动脉VTI).
- 肺湿干比率,病理评分和ROC分析被用于评估损伤和诊断性能.
主要成果:
- 严重的ALI显示了显著更高的肺W/D比率和病理学得分.
- 冠状动脉FTc和肺动脉VTI与ALI严重程度下降,与肺损伤标志物负相关.
- 肺动脉VTI表现出高的诊断性能 (AUC>0.8),通过结合心血管FTc (AUC>0.95在6h).
结论:
- 肺动脉VTI是评估ALI严重性的可靠指标.
- 肺动脉VTI和动脉FTc的组合为ALI严重性评估提供了强大的诊断能力.

Ultrasonography
4.3K
Ultrasonography is an imaging technique that uses high-frequency sound waves to visualize the body's internal structures. It is a non-invasive and safe procedure that does not involve the use of ionizing radiation, making it widely used in various medical fields. Ultrasonography is used to study heart function, blood flow in the neck or extremities, certain conditions such as gallbladder disease, and fetal growth and development.
